Zac Brown Band's Sphere Setlist Revealed: Every Song Played on the First Night of Their Las Vegas Residency
Zac Brown Band kicked off their highly anticipated eight-date residency at Las Vegas' iconic Sphere venue last Friday night, delivering a show that was packed with hits and fan favorites. The band also released its new album, Love & Fear, on the same day, which further solidified the excitement surrounding this unique collaboration between music, technology, and immersive storytelling.
According to reports from Billboard, the band's setlist for the first night of their residency featured a total of 26 songs, drawing heavily from their new album, with seven tracks performed. The other 19 songs spanned the band's extensive discography, showcasing their growth and evolution over the years.
The Sphere venue proved to be an ideal platform for Zac Brown Band's performance, allowing them to showcase their signature sound in a more immersive and interactive way. The band's lead singer and founder, Zac Brown, has always been known for his passion and creativity, and it seems that this residency is no exception.
In an interview with Billboard earlier this year, Brown discussed the band's plans for the residency, stating, "I've been wanting to do a spectacle for a couple of years. I've been planning to figure out how to do something where the production and the fan experience is just on another level." He also expressed his excitement about working with the Sphere venue, calling it "the greatest canvas that's ever been created for imagination."
